Greenwoods gets Cambridge base through merger

Robert Dillarstone, Managing Director, Greenwoods Solicitors LLP

Peterborough law firm, Greenwoods Solicitors LLP, has merged with Walker Wallis in Cambridge.

As a result of the merger, Greenwoods now has a Cambridge office at Cambridge Business Park. The merged firm will operate under the Greenwoods name and brand.

Walker Wallis’s directors, Duncan Walker and Huw Wallis, are now directors and members of Greenwoods Solicitors LLP; Walker in the Corporate & Commercial team, and Wallis as Head of Commercial Dispute Resolution.

Robert Dillarstone, Greenwoods’ Managing Director, said: “Merging with Walker Wallis is great news for both firms - Greenwoods now has the opportunity to access the Cambridge marketplace from a position of strength whilst Walker Wallis clients are able to enjoy a wider range of services and skills.”

“Duncan and Huw are top drawer lawyers and we all feel that there is a very good fit between our respective firms. We all hit it off from the word go, principally because our approach to business is the same. Despite these continuing tough economic times, we are viewing the future with much anticipation and excitement.”

Talking about the decision to merge, Duncan Walker and Huw Wallis said: “During discussions at the end of last year, it became clear that Greenwoods and Walker Wallis shared the same approach to running and developing their businesses. Our businesses held the same values and the cultures of the two firms mirrored each other. Working together we can be an even more powerful force in the legal marketplace.”

Walker Wallis had been enjoying a very strong first two years and was at a “crossroads” in terms of its next steps for growth. As a result, it was exactly the right time to merge. Greenwoods is now looking to build on its strengths in Peterborough whilst supporting and developing its Cambridge office to reach its full potential.
